The Legacy of Houston Basketball: More Than Just a Game

When you talk about NCAA Houston basketball, you're not just talking about a team; you're talking about a legacy. This program has a storied past that resonates deeply within college basketball circles. Think about the legendary Phi Slama Jama era in the 1980s, led by none other than Hakeem Olajuwon and Clyde Drexler. These guys weren't just players; they were pioneers, revolutionizing the game with their above-the-rim play and electrifying dunks. Phi Slama Jama wasn't just a nickname; it was a movement that put Houston basketball on the national map and inspired a generation of hoopers. The impact of that era is still felt today, a constant reminder of the program's potential for greatness.
